Q: Is 2,200,538 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,200,538 is a composite number.

Why is 2,200,538 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,200,538 can be evenly divided by 1 2 37 74 131 227 262 454 4,847 8,399 9,694 16,798 29,737 59,474 1,100,269 and 2,200,538, with no remainder.

Since 2,200,538 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,200,538, it is a composite number.
